Are Cryptocurrencies Doomed

WEB Will crypto recover or is the industry truly doomed in 2023 and beyond?

The recent crypto crash has left many wondering if the industry is doomed

In recent months, the cryptocurrency market has experienced a significant downturn. Bitcoin, the largest cryptocurrency by market capitalization, has fallen by more than 50% since its all-time high in November 2021. Other cryptocurrencies have also seen sharp declines in value. This has led to widespread speculation about the future of the cryptocurrency industry. Some experts believe that the industry is doomed, while others believe that it will eventually recover.

There are a number of factors that have contributed to the recent crypto crash

One factor is the rising interest rates by the Federal Reserve. This has made it more expensive for crypto investors to borrow money, which has led to a decrease in demand for cryptocurrencies. Another factor is the increasing regulatory scrutiny of the cryptocurrency industry. This has made it more difficult for crypto companies to operate, which has also led to a decrease in demand for cryptocurrencies.

Despite the recent crypto crash, there are still a number of reasons to be optimistic about the future of the industry

One reason is that the underlying technology behind cryptocurrencies, blockchain, is still very promising. Blockchain is a secure and efficient way to store and transfer data, and it has the potential to revolutionize a wide range of industries. Another reason to be optimistic is that there is still a lot of interest in cryptocurrencies from institutional investors. These investors are looking for ways to diversify their portfolios, and they see cryptocurrencies as a potential investment opportunity. Finally, there is still a lot of development activity happening in the cryptocurrency industry. New projects are being launched all the time, and this is helping to drive innovation and adoption of cryptocurrencies.

Ultimately, the future of the cryptocurrency industry is uncertain

However, there are a number of reasons to be optimistic about the industry's long-term prospects. The underlying technology behind cryptocurrencies is sound, there is still a lot of interest in cryptocurrencies from institutional investors, and there is still a lot of development activity happening in the industry.
